Analysis
In 2025, computer, communications and other services in United States of America stood at 40.1%.
The figure is up 1.3% on the previous year and down 0.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, computer, communications and other services in United States of America peaked at 52.9%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 7.1%, in 1981.
United States of America ranks 79th of 198 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 56 years of available data.

About this data
Computer, communications and other services include such activities as international telecommunications, and postal and courier services; computer data; news-related service transactions between residents and nonresidents; construction services; royalties and license fees; miscellaneous business, professional, and technical services; and personal, cultural, and recreational services.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of service imports which are commercial services provided by non-residents to residents.
